Commercial Slab Installation in Harrisburg, PA
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ete slabs that serve as the foundation for various structures on a property. These projects typically include building foundations for warehouses, retail stores, parking lots, loading docks, and other large-scale commercial facilities. Property owners often seek these services to ensure a stable, level base that can support heavy equipment, foot traffic, or vehicular loads, making it a critical step in construction or renovation projects.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the work, including site preparation, soil assessment, and the type of concrete used. It’s also important to consider the size and design of the slab, drainage needs, and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. Clear communication about project requirements and conditions can help ensure the installation process meets expectations and provides a durable, long-lasting foundation.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or storage areas on commercial properties.
What materials are typically used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material, often reinforced with steel to enhance strength and durability for heavy use.
How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ness varies based on the intended use, but generally ranges from 4 to 8 inches for most commercial applications.
What should property owners consider before installation? Proper site preparation, soil conditions, and load requirements are important factors to ensure a stable and long-lasting slab.
